System and method for outputting filter monitoring system information via telematics

A filter monitoring system and method are described. The filter monitoring system includes a module or circuit installed on an internal combustion engine or within a vehicle powered by the internal combustion engine. The filter monitoring system monitors the operation of the various filtration systems present on the engine to determine an amount of service life remaining and a loading percentage for various filter cartridges installed in the filtration systems of the internal combustion engine. The filter monitoring system determines the loading percentage and predicts remaining service life of a given filter cartridge via a time-based manner (e.g., based on the installation date of the filter cartridge and filter cartridge life specifications) and a pressure differential based manner (e.g., based on a determination of pressure drop across the filter cartridge).

Apparatus and methods for remotely monitoring water utilization

An apparatus and method for remotely monitoring water usage in real time utilizes a sensor attached to a water meter. The sensor monitors water flowing through the meter by analyzing the water meter's magnetic coupling and processes the data to correlate it to real time flow rates. Data is transmitted through a base unit to remote storage and consumers may access the data with application software installed on electronics such as smartphones and tablets. Four components are combined to allow the real time monitoring of water utilization.

Wireless sensor with multiple sensing options
10746682 · 2020-08-18 · ·

A wireless sensor includes an antenna, a sensing integrated circuit (IC), and a power supply impedance altering element. The antenna is operable to receive an inbound radio frequency (RF) signal and to transmit an outbound RF signal. The sensing IC includes a power supply, a first power supply connection, and a second power supply connection. The power supply impedance altering element is coupled to the first and second power supply connections and is coupled to sense a condition of an item. The sensing IC is operable to detect an impedance change of the power supply based on an effect of the power supply impedance altering element. The sensing IC is further operable to convert the impedance change into a digital value that represents the condition of the item. The sensing IC is further operable to output, via the antenna, the digital value or a representation of the condition.

Water meter transmitter housing

A submetering meter housing is sized and shaped to receive and mount a transmitter circuit board in an integrated fashion to the meter to provide electronic meter monitoring of the submetering meter. The submetering meter housing includes a switch circuit board with a counter reed switch that is connected to the count input of the transmitter circuit board, and positioned to open and close in response to the rotation of a permanent magnet included within the meter, and a tamper reed switch that is connected to the tamper input of the transmitter circuit board, and positioned to close in response to the presence of a permanent magnet included in the meter lens, so that disassembly of the submetering meter which separates the tamper reed switch from the meter lens causes a tamper signal to be transmitted by the transmitter circuit board.

METERING SYSTEM RESPONSE BASED ON INCIDENT-RELATED NOTIFICATION FROM THIRD PARTY SYSTEM
20200173810 · 2020-06-04 · ·

A metering device and method for assessing an incident detected by a safety monitoring system at a physical site at which the metering device is located, the method including: receiving at the metering device sensor layout information for safety monitoring system sensors, receiving a notification from the safety monitoring system including sensor data, determining an incident type and severity index(es) based on the sensor layout information and the sensor data, evaluating the severity index(es) against predetermined criteria, and taking an action based on the evaluation. The sensor data may include sensor identification as well as smoke intensities, temperatures, water pressure, and/or flood levels, etc., reported by the sensors. The actions taken may include disconnecting flow at the metering device, sending an instruction message to other metering device(s) to disconnect flow, and/or sending an alarm message to a device associated with a utility provider associated with the metering device.

BRIDGE DEVICE FOR WIRELESS SENSORS
20200137533 · 2020-04-30 ·

A sensing system includes a wireless sensor configured to generate data corresponding to an environmental condition; a thermostat configured to control an HVAC system in response to the data; a bridge device configured to receive the data from the wireless sensor and configured to transmit the data to the thermostat; wherein the bridge device is configured to communicate with the thermostat using a first communication protocol and configured to communicate with the wireless sensor using a second communication protocol.
